491. God of all power, and truth, and grace

1 God of all power, and truth, and grace,
Which shall from age to age endure,
Whose word, when heaven and earth shall pass,
Remains and stands for ever sure;

2 That I Thy mercy may proclaim,
That all mankind Thy truth may see,
Hallow Thy great and glorious name,
And perfect holiness in me.

3 Purge me from every sinful blot;
My idols all be cast aside;
Cleanse me from every sinful thought,
From all the filth of self and pride.

4 Give me a new, a perfect heart,
From doubt, and fear, and sorrow free;
The mind which was in Christ impart,
And let my spirit cleave to Thee.

5 O that I now, from sin released,
Thy word may to the utmost prove,
Enter into the promised rest,
The Canaan of Thy perfect love!

Text Information
First Line: God of all power, and truth, and grace
Author: C. Wesley, 1707-1788
Language: English
Publication Date: 1917
Topic: Holy Spirit: Sanctifying; Thoughts: Sinful; Cleansing (9 more...)
Tune Information
Name: WARRINGTON
Composer: Ralph Harrison, 1748-1810
Meter: L.M.
Key: C Major
